What is the Data Migration Process?

The data migration process involves transferring data between storage types, formats, databases, or systems. It is commonly required when:

  • Upgrading from legacy systems to modern ERP platforms (like SAP S/4HANA)

  • Moving data from on-premises environments to c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, Google Cloud)

  • Consolidating disparate databases post-merger or acquisition

  • Modernizing IT infrastructure for scalability and agility

A robust data migration process ensures data integrity, security, and usability in the new environment—enabling businesses to leverage advanced capabilities and improved efficiency.


Key Challenges in the Data Migration Process

Despite its importance, the data migration process often poses several challenges, including:

  1. Poor Data Quality
    Legacy systems tend to accumulate outdated, inconsistent, or duplicate records. Migrating low-quality data can compromise decision-making and operational efficiency.

  2. Complex Data Mapping and Transformation
    Data structures, formats, and schemas often vary between source and target systems. Aligning them correctly demands precise mapping and transformation logic.

  3. Data Loss and Corruption Risks
    Incomplete migrations or mismatched data fields can result in data loss, corruption, or integrity issues.

  4. Extended Downtime and Business Disruption
    Without careful planning, the migration process can lead to significant system downtime, affecting productivity and customer experience.

  5. Regulatory and Compliance Constraints
    Handling sensitive or regulated data during migration requires strict adherence to data protection laws like GDPR, HIPAA, or SOX.

  6. Integration Complexity
    Ensuring that migrated data seamlessly integrates with existing applications and workflows is critical to business continuity.

  7. Lack of Expertise and Project Management
    Insufficient technical skills, poor planning, and lack of governance can derail even well-intentioned migration projects.

Best Practices for a Successful Data Migration Process

1. Define Clear Objectives and Scope

Outline your migration goals, timelines, data sets, and key performance indicators (KPIs). Clarity in objectives aligns stakeholders and guides project execution.

2. Cleanse and Enrich Data Early

Prioritize data cleansing and standardization to improve accuracy, eliminate redundancies, and reduce storage costs in the target system.

3. Develop a Detailed Migration Plan

Create a roadmap covering:

  • Migration methodology (big bang vs. phased)

  • Resource allocation and responsibilities

  • Risk assessment and mitigation strategies

  • Testing and validation protocols

4. Test at Every Stage

Conduct iterative testing—including unit tests, system integration tests, and user acceptance tests (UAT)—to validate data accuracy and functionality at each step.

5. Communicate and Train

Maintain transparent communication with IT teams, business leaders, and end-users. Offer training to ensure users are comfortable with the new system post-migration.

6. Monitor and Optimize Post-Migration

After go-live, monitor system performance, validate data integrity, and gather user feedback. Fine-tune processes to optimize outcomes.
